ENSG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2023 in Review

339 of the 6,275 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in The Ensign Group (ENSG) for Q1 2023, worth a combined $4.94B — up 6.3% from $4.64B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 32 funds opened new ENSG positions and 30 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 139 added to existing stakes and 119 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Capital Research Global Investors, adding an estimated $82M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$37.7M.
